Demographic data table of Chamarajanagar

  • The population of Chamarajanagar district is 10.21 Lakh, with a male population of 5.12 Lakh and a female population of 5.09 Lakh.
  • The total Sex raio of Chamarajanagar is 993/1000 which is higher than India's sex ratio of 943/1000.
  • The district has a literacy rate of 61.43%, which is lower than the national literacy rate of 74.04%.

Facts
  • Total population of Chamarajanagar is 10,20,791.
  • Chamarajanagar is the 28th most populated district in Karnataka.
  • 1.67% of the total population of Karnataka lives in Chamarajanagar.
  • Karnataka's total population is 6.11 Crore.

Facts
  • Rural population of Chamarajanagar is 8,45,817.
  • 82.86% of the total population of Chamarajanagar lives in rural area.
  • 61.33% of the total population of Karnataka lives in rural area.
  • Karnataka's rural population is 3.75 Crore.

Facts
  • The sex ratio of Chamarajanagar is 993/1000.
  • In terms of sex ratio, Chamarajanagar stands at 9th position out of 30 districts of Karnataka.
  • Chamarajanagar's sex ratio is above the sex ratio of Karnataka.
  • Chamarajanagar's sex ratio is above the sex ratio of India.

    Facts
    • The litearcy rate of Chamarajanagar is 61.43% which ranks at 28th position out of 30 districts of Karnataka.
    • Chamarajanagar's literacy rate is below the literacy rate of Karnataka (75.36%)
    • Chamarajanagar's literacy rate is below the literacy rate of India (74.04%)
    • Male and Female literacy rate is 67.93% and 54.92% respectively.

    Facts
    • Chamarajanagar's worker population ratio(WPR) is 47.19%; in other words, 47.19% of the population is employed.
    • The WPR of Chamarajanagar is higher than the WPR of Karnataka and higher than the WPR of India.
    • Male WPR in Chamarajanagar is 63.32% while female WPR is 30.94%.
